Discovering a reliable representative for service of process in Florida is a critical step for any business or private associated with lawful proceedings within the state. This marked agent acts as the main factor of contact for obtaining legal files, such as subpoenas, complaints, or summonses, making certain that vital legal notices are properly delivered and acknowledged. The role of the agent is mandated by Florida regulation, which requires companies, LLCs, and other entities to maintain a signed up agent with a physical address within the state. Selecting the ideal representative can streamline lawful procedures, protect against missed target dates, and make sure compliance with state regulations. Numerous services opt to work with professional signed up agent solutions to manage this obligation, as they provide integrity, competence, and conformity monitoring. Additionally, an agent for solution of procedure need to be readily available throughout regular company hours to accept solution in support of the entity, making their accessibility important to maintaining lawful standing. It is additionally crucial for the agent to maintain precise records of all obtained papers and quickly inform the business owner or lawful team as required. Stopping working to keep a registered representative or giving incorrect details can cause charges, default judgments, or legal issues that may negatively influence the entity's operations. Recognizing the advantages, duties, and demands linked with appointing an agent for service of procedure in Florida is vital for maintaining good legal standing and making sure smooth handling of lawful matters. Whether selecting a specific or an expert service, entities have to make certain that their agent is trusted, easily accessible, and certified with Florida laws to avoid any prospective mistakes in lawful procedures.
